BACKGROUND: Midface rejuvenation is important to restore a youthful and appealing appearance. However, there are several problems existed in the treatment of fat grafting, including low fat retention and undesired aesthetic outcomes. OBJECTIVE: To objectively evaluate the efficacy of midface fat grafting, and analyze the problems encountered in this process to increase patient satisfaction. METHODS: Thirty-two patients who underwent autologous fat grafting for midface augmentation were included. Facial analysis was performed based on preoperative and postoperative photographs. Satisfaction outcome was assessed by the patient, the surgeon, and a layperson postoperatively. RESULTS: After treatment, 87.5% of the patients were assessed as satisfactory and mostly satisfactory based on facial proportion and complications. The postoperative medial cheek projection was 1.92±0.26 times the height of the preoperative one ( P <0.01). A smooth lid-cheek junction, a single convex, and ameliorated nasolabial groove were obtained. The dark coloration and wrinkles in lower eyelid were improved. The most common complication was overcorrection, which could be resolved with further treatments. CONCLUSIONS: Autologous fat grafting remains an optimal option for midface rejuvenation with satisfactory results. Most of the complications are preventable and optimal outcomes can be obtained through correct comprehension of aesthetic features and proper operations.

BACKGROUND: This study aims to observe and investigate the clinical value of scar loosening and tissue-expansive autologous skin grafting in the treatment of postburn scars and independent risk characteristics for surgery-related complications. METHODS: We retrospectively analyzed 94 cases with postburn scars, and all patients were treated with scar loosening and autologous skin grafting. Overall therapeutic effects were evaluated using the standard of cure and improvement of clinical diseases. Burn Specific Health Scale-brief was used to analyze patients' quality of life. The visual analog scale scores were used to analyze esthetic satisfaction. Surgery-related complications were recorded, and logistic regression model was used to analyze independent factors affecting surgery-related complications. RESULTS: As for overall efficacy evaluation, 50 cases were cured, 19 cases were markedly improved, 17 cases improved, and 8 cases were detected and tested, and the overall effective rate was 91.4%. The Burn Specific Health Scale-brief and visual analog scale score showed a trend of increasing gradually. It indicated that the patients were satisfied with the operation and their quality of life was improved. The logistic regression model showed that history of skin disease (OR=1.53 (1.08-2.16), P =0.02) and skin area (OR=2.50 (1.22-4.50), P <0.01) were significantly associated with surgery-related complications. CONCLUSIONS: Scar loosening and autologous skin grafting is a safe and effective treatment. The history of skin disease and skin area was the independent factors for surgery-related complications.

A facile one-step method for the synthesis of a water-soluble selenium/polypyrrole (Se/PPy) nanocomposite was developed. In the aqueous synthesis process, the pyrrole acted as a reductant for the reduction of H2SeO3, and then the elemental Se formed in situ acted as a catalyst for the polymerization of pyrrole. The characterization results show that the as-obtained composite (Se/PPy) is a spherical (Φ80 nm) product that is made up of amorphous Se particles coated by PPy layers. The formation mechanism and influence factors of the products were discussed, based on a series of experiments. It is proposed that remainder H2SeO3 adsorbed on the PPy chains increased the water-solubility and conductivity of the Se/PPy nanocomposite. Significantly, relying on the synergistic effect of photo-conductive Se nanoparticles and electric-conductive PPy molecules, the Se/PPy nanocomposite possesses a large two-photon absorption (2PA) cross-section and good optical limiting properties, which were demonstrated by the Z-scan technique using a femtosecond laser. We believe that this work should be an interesting strategy for developing polymer composites with excellent optoelectrical properties.

BACKGROUND: To correct nasal tip cephalic rotation, SEG made of cartilage or Medpor are often used in rhinoplasty. These techniques require extensive experience for the surgeon, and not all patients can accept this procedure. In this research, we introduce a new method to correct nasal tip cephalic rotation that is relatively simple and rapid. METHODS: Fifty-nine patients who had rhinoplasty using our scaffold were enrolled in the study between January 2020 and January 2021. The authors evaluated the change of nasolabial angel by photogrammetry using standardized clinical photogrammetric techniques. Patients' satisfaction regarding postoperative results was also surveyed. RESULTS: The mean postoperative follow-up duration was 12 months. No complication (infection, extrusion, and displacement) was happened in all patients. Analysis showed our scaffold can correct nasal tip cephalic rotation effectively (98.61±1.21 preoperatively and 89.68±0.99 postoperatively, P<0.0001). And the patient satisfaction rate is 98%. CONCLUSION: We constructed an integrated scaffold by simply folding and suturing a high-density polyethylene sheet (Su-Por) sheet to correct nasal tip cephalic rotation. Using the scaffold we designed, we did not need to alter the structure of the nasal septum, which reduced the operative duration and simplified the surgical procedure.

The cobalt spectrum measurement was conducted with the experiment setup including a Nd : YAG Q-switched solid laser as the exciting light, and YG hard alloy as the sample. Experiments show that the 345. 35 nm sensitive spectral line intensity of Co in YG3 demonstrates a parabola trend with the increase in power density, and as the power density exceeds 1. 2 X 10(8) W x cm(-2), the spectrum intensity becomes stronger, and its deflection becomes less. The experiments on measuring Co concentration in YG hard alloy series show that the concentration of cobalt has a good linear relationship with its spectral intensity, the maximum relative error of measurement is 5. 08%, and the result is reliable with higher precision.

An experimental equipment has been set up for laser-induced plasma spectroscopic (LIPS) measurement based on a Nd: YAG Q-switched solid laser (average single pulse energy is 38 mJ) as exciting light source and the copper alloy as sample. The instrument time distribution of Cu radiation was obtained, and the software and hardware influence factors on the measured spectra were analyzed. The experiments proved that the fluctuation of laser output energy, average number of each datum, the position between the target surface and the lens focus, the position between the optical fiber bundle for receiving the radiation and the normal of the target surface, and the effective receiving area of the optical fiber bundle all influence the intensity of spectra and the reproducibility of measurement.

Biopsy of sentinel lymph node (SLN) has become a common practice to predict whether tumor metastasis has occurred, so proper SLN positioning tracers are highly required. Due to many drawbacks of SLN tracers currently used, developing ideal, biosafe SLN imaging agents is always an urgent issue. The current study designed a novel fluorescent nanoprobe for accurate SLN mapping. Dextran-based nanogel (DNG) was prepared through a highly efficient self-assembly assisted approach and serves as a multi-functional platform for conjugating wide spectra emitting fluorescent agents. The newly fabricated fluorescent DNG (FDNG) could be designed with optimum size and stable fluorescent intensity for specific SLN imaging. Furthermore, a long-term dynamic course in vivo (from 1 min to 72 h) revealed the satisfactory specificity, sensitivity, and stability for SLN mapping. Most importantly, both in vitro and in vivo evaluations indicated that FDNG had fine biosafety and biocompatibility with lymphatic endothelial cells. All these results supported that FDNG could be used as highly efficient molecular imaging probes for specific, sensitive, stable, non-invasive, and safe SLN mapping, which provides efficient and accurate location for SLN biopsy and thus predicts tumor metastasis as well as directs therapies. Besides, our recent studies further demonstrated that DNG could also serve as a specific and controllable drug carrier, indicating a potential application for specific therapies of various lymph-associated diseases.
